# Gebeta：本地优先的AI代码助手，守护代码主权

> Gebeta 是一款本地优先的AI工程环境，让开发团队在不暴露专有代码的前提下，利用AI完成编码、审查、重构、测试和代理工作流执行，为注重代码安全的企业提供私有化AI开发解决方案。

- 板块: [Openclaw Llm](https://www.zingnex.cn/forum/board/openclaw-llm)
- 发布时间: 2026-04-11T05:42:08.000Z
- 最近活动: 2026-04-11T05:45:45.963Z
- 热度: 159.9
- 关键词: Gebeta, AI代码助手, 本地优先, 代码主权, 私有化部署, 代码安全, 离线开发, 开源模型
- 页面链接: https://www.zingnex.cn/forum/thread/gebeta-ai
- Canonical: https://www.zingnex.cn/forum/thread/gebeta-ai
- Markdown 来源: ingested_event

---

# Gebeta：本地优先的AI代码助手，守护代码主权

随着AI编程助手在开发流程中的普及，一个日益凸显的矛盾摆在企业和开发者面前：如何在享受AI带来的效率提升的同时，保护核心代码资产不被泄露给第三方服务提供商？Gebeta Sovereign Code Assistant 正是针对这一问题提出的解决方案，它倡导"本地优先"理念，让AI能力真正运行在用户可控的环境中。

## 项目背景与核心理念

Gebeta 项目的诞生源于对代码主权（Code Sovereignty）的重视。当前主流AI编程工具如GitHub Copilot、Cursor等，虽然功能强大，但都需要将代码片段发送到云端服务器进行处理。对于处理敏感数据、核心算法或受监管行业代码的企业而言，这种模式存在合规风险和知识产权隐患。

Gebeta 的核心理念可以概括为："AI加速工程，但不移除人类控制"。项目致力于构建一个完整的本地AI工程环境，让开发团队能够在完全离线的环境中使用AI辅助开发，同时保留对数据和模型的完全控制权。

## 功能架构全景

Gebeta 提供了一套完整的AI工程工具链，覆盖开发周期的多个环节：

### 智能代码生成与补全

基于本地部署的大语言模型，Gebeta 能够理解代码上下文，提供智能补全建议。与云端服务不同的是，所有模型推理都在本地完成，代码不会离开用户的机器或私有服务器。这种架构特别适合对数据驻留有严格要求的场景。

### 代码审查与质量分析

Gebeta 集成了代码审查功能，可以自动检测潜在的安全漏洞、性能瓶颈和代码异味。审查规则支持自定义，团队可以根据自身编码规范配置检查策略。审查报告以结构化形式呈现，便于集成到CI/CD流程中。

### 自动化重构建议

面对遗留代码或技术债务，Gebeta 能够分析代码结构，提出重构建议并生成重构后的代码示例。这一功能有助于团队逐步改善代码质量，降低维护成本。

### 测试生成与执行

测试是保障代码质量的关键环节。Gebeta 支持根据代码逻辑自动生成单元测试用例，并能在隔离环境中执行测试，验证代码行为。这种自动化能力显著降低了编写测试的工作量，提高了测试覆盖率。

### 代理工作流执行

作为项目的特色功能，Gebeta 支持定义和执行复杂的代理工作流（Agent Workflows）。开发者可以编排多步骤的AI任务，如"分析代码变更→生成文档→更新测试→提交审查"。这些工作流在本地执行，确保敏感操作不经过外部服务。

## 技术实现与部署模式

Gebeta 采用模块化架构，核心组件包括：

- **模型运行时**：支持多种本地模型推理后端，包括Ollama、llama.cpp等，用户可根据硬件条件选择合适的模型规模。
- **代码分析引擎**：基于Tree-sitter构建的代码解析层，支持多种编程语言的深度分析。
- **知识表示层**：将代码库结构化为可查询的知识图谱，支持跨文件、跨模块的语义理解。
- **工作流引擎**：负责任务编排和状态管理，支持条件分支、并行执行和错误恢复。

在部署模式上，Gebeta 提供灵活的选择：

**个人开发者模式**：在个人工作站上运行完整的AI开发环境，所有数据保存在本地。

**团队私有部署**：在企业内网或私有云中部署共享服务，团队成员通过API或Web界面访问，代码仍保留在私有基础设施内。

**混合模式**：对于非敏感代码使用云端模型，核心代码使用本地模型，实现效率与安全的平衡。

## 与主流工具的对比

| 维度 | Gebeta | GitHub Copilot | Cursor |
|------|--------|----------------|--------|
| 部署方式 | 本地/私有云 | 云端SaaS | 云端SaaS |
| 代码隐私 | 完全本地，零外泄 | 代码片段上传云端 | 代码片段上传云端 |
| 模型选择 | 灵活，支持多种开源模型 | 固定OpenAI模型 | 固定OpenAI/Claude模型 |
| 定制化 | 高度可定制 | 有限 | 中等 |
| 离线能力 | 完全支持 | 不支持 | 不支持 |
| 企业合规 | 易于满足 | 需额外评估 | 需额外评估 |

这种对比并非要否定云端工具的价值，而是为不同需求的用户提供选择。对于开源项目或个人学习，云端工具往往更加便捷；而对于处理敏感数据的企业，Gebeta 提供了合规的替代方案。

## 适用场景与价值主张

Gebeta 特别适合以下场景：

**金融科技行业**：处理交易算法、风控模型等核心代码时，必须确保代码不离开受控环境。

**医疗健康领域**：涉及患者数据的代码需要符合HIPAA、GDPR等严格的数据保护法规。

**国防与政府项目**：涉密代码的开发环境通常要求完全物理隔离。

**知识产权保护**：对于拥有核心算法专利的企业，防止代码泄露是商业机密保护的关键。

**高度定制化需求**：需要在模型行为、审查规则、工作流等方面进行深度定制的团队。

## 使用门槛与权衡

选择本地优先方案也意味着需要承担额外的运维责任：

**硬件要求**：运行本地大模型需要足够的GPU资源，相比云端方案有更高的硬件门槛。

**模型管理**：用户需要自行管理模型版本、更新和优化，增加了运维复杂度。

**功能更新**：云端服务通常能更快获得模型能力更新，本地部署需要手动跟进。

**社区生态**：相比成熟的云端工具，本地方案的插件生态和社区资源相对较少。

这些权衡需要团队根据自身情况评估。对于安全合规要求严格的组织，这些额外成本往往是值得的。

## 未来展望

随着开源大语言模型的快速发展和硬件成本的持续下降，本地AI开发环境的可行性正在不断提升。Gebeta 所代表的"主权AI"理念可能会成为企业级开发工具的重要分支。

项目未来可能的发展方向包括：更广泛的编程语言支持、与主流IDE的深度集成、更智能的本地知识库管理、以及更完善的团队协作功能。无论技术如何演进，"让用户掌控自己的代码和数据"这一核心原则将持续指导项目发展。

## 总结

Gebeta Sovereign Code Assistant 为AI辅助开发提供了一个重要的替代路径。它证明了在享受AI效率红利的同时，也可以保持对核心资产的完全控制。对于面临数据合规压力、知识产权风险或网络隔离要求的企业和开发者而言，这是一个值得认真评估的选择。

在AI工具日益普及的今天，了解不同架构模式的优劣，选择最适合自身需求的方案，是技术决策者需要具备的能力。Gebeta 的存在丰富了这一选择谱系，推动了AI开发工具向更加多元化、安全可控的方向发展。
